
Uranium Sector a 'Coiled Spring' - Coming Prices Will Shock the Market: Roger Lemaitre
About this episode
Roger Lemaitre sees the writing on the wall when it comes to the supply-demand dynamics for uranium, and he sees the sector as a coiled spring, with prices set to be unleased to levels that will shock those who aren't paying attention. After a lull in uranium stocks, the miners seem to be waking up and Roger believes that when the supply deficit is truly recognized by investors, the gains ahead could be legendary.
